I agree with HobieKopek. I don't think that a brand new car would be the way to go, especially if you're planning on upgrading (to an evo or whatever) in a few years. The big reason is that as soon as you buy a car, it depreciates.
So, if you go to trade it in for something else, you not only have to buy the new car, you have to pay the ammount owed on the car (more than you expect due to tax, title, interest, etc.) you originally bought, minus what they give you for trade in (which will be lower from depreciation). Even on a relatively inexpensive car, this can ammount to a few thousand dollars (due to intrest).
If you are hell bent on a new car, a large down payment really helps with this. The key at trade in time is to have the trade-in on the car exceed what you owe on it.
